2001 pontiac grand prix 3.8 ltr. 60,000 miles

Ignition key is stuck in ignition.. Will not rotate back to off position so key can be removed.
Key moves forward and car starts fine, just can't remove key...
Any advice appreciated...

if you sifter is on the floor check that the button that you press that let you shift from park to drive is not stuck in the in possition if so it will not allow you to remove you key

I am having the same problem, along with some others.

I have not found a permanent solution, but if you look under the steering column directly below where the key is you'll see a little plastic cap. Pop out the cap with a small screw driver, then take a drinking straw and push it into the whole while you tun your key back.

I wish I could find a proper fix for this, but this is what I am doing for now.
